Kalstein+ is an integrated marketplace for the scientific and industrial equipment sector. According to the description, its core positioning is to connect customers, distributors, and manufacturers, allowing equipment inquiries, purchases, and management to be handled within the same platform. Compared with general e-commerce platforms, it is more of a vertical B2B marketplace or a specialized equipment trading platform, serving users across the research, laboratory, and industrial equipment supply chain.
Based on the available information, Kalstein+ has three main capabilities: first, it connects supply and demand as a global scientific equipment marketplace; second, it supports customers in requesting quotations, referred to as “cotiza”; and third, it supports equipment purchasing and management. On the supply-chain side, the platform emphasizes participation from manufacturers and distributors, which suggests it is not merely a single-brand official website but has multi-party transaction-matching features.
